Как вычислить корень четвертой степени в Excel: 5 проверенных способов с примерами

Введение: зачем нужны корни четвертой степени в Excel

Вычисление корня четвертой степени в Microsoft Excel — задача, с которой сталкиваются инженеры, финансовые аналитики и студенты при решении уравнений, расчете процентных ставок или обработке статистических данных. В отличие от квадратного корня, который имеет dedicated функцию КОРЕНЬ(), корень четвертой степени требует комбинации математических операций или использования степенных функций.

На практике такие вычисления востребованы при анализе роста инвестиций (где четвертый корень помогает найти среднегодовой темп прироста за 4 периода), в физике для расчета объемных характеристик или при решении алгебраических уравнений высоких степеней. Эта статья раскроет 5 способов вычисления — от базовых до продвинутых, с учетом особенностей работы с отрицательными числами и комплексными результатами.

Мы разберем не только синтаксис формул, но и типичные ошибки (например, почему #ЧИСЛО! появляется при извлечении корня из отрицательного значения), а также оптимизируем расчеты для больших массивов данных. Если вы работаете с Excel 365, Excel 2019 или более ранними версиями — все методы будут актуальны.

Способ 1: Использование оператора возведения в степень (^)

Самый универсальный и лаконичный метод — возвести число в дробную степень 1/4. В Excel для этого используется оператор ^ (циркумфлекс), который работает во всех версиях программы, включая Excel для Mac и онлайн-версию.

Формула имеет вид:

=A1^(1/4)

где A1 — адрес ячейки с исходным числом. Например, для вычисления корня четвертой степени из 81 (результат = 3) формула будет:

=81^(1/4)
  • Плюсы: работает во всех версиях Excel, не требует дополнительных функций.
  • ⚠️ Минусы: при извлечении корня из отрицательного числа вернет ошибку #ЧИСЛО! (решение — см. раздел про комплексные числа).
  • 🔄 Альтернатива: можно использовать функцию СТЕПЕНЬ()=СТЕПЕНЬ(A1; 1/4).
⚠️ Внимание: Если вы копируете формулу в другие ячейки, убедитесь, что ссылка на A1 относительная (без знака $). Иначе при протягивании маркера автозаполнения адрес не будет обновляться.
📊 Какой способ вычисления корней вам знаком?
Оператор ^
Функция КОРЕНЬ
Функция СТЕПЕНЬ
Другой
Не знаю

Способ 2: Комбинация функций КОРЕНЬ() и СТЕПЕНЬ()

Для тех, кто предпочитает использовать встроенные функции вместо операторов, подойдет комбинация КОРЕНЬ() (извлекает квадратный корень) и СТЕПЕНЬ(). Логика проста: корень четвертой степени эквивалентен двукратному извлечению квадратного корня.

Формула:

=КОРЕНЬ(КОРЕНЬ(A1))

или с использованием СТЕПЕНЬ():

=СТЕПЕНЬ(A1; 0,25)
Исходное число Формула с ^ Формула с КОРЕНЬ() Формула с СТЕПЕНЬ() Результат
16 =16^(1/4) =КОРЕНЬ(КОРЕНЬ(16)) =СТЕПЕНЬ(16; 0,25) 2
81 =81^(1/4) =КОРЕНЬ(КОРЕНЬ(81)) =СТЕПЕНЬ(81; 0,25) 3
-16 #ЧИСЛО! #ЧИСЛО! #ЧИСЛО! Ошибка

Этот метод удобен для визуализации процесса: сначала извлекается квадратный корень из числа, затем — квадратный корень из результата. Однако он не подходит для автоматизации расчетов в больших таблицах, так как требует вложенных функций.

Убедиться, что число не отрицательное|Проверить формат ячейки (общий/числовой)|Сравнить результат с калькулятором|Протянуть формулу на весь диапазон данных-->

Способ 3: Функция СТЕПЕНЬ() с отрицательным показателем

Функция СТЕПЕНЬ() в Excel позволяет возводить число в любую степень, включая дробные и отрицательные. Для корня четвертой степени показатель степени равен 0.25 (или 1/4). Синтаксис:

=СТЕПЕНЬ(число; 0,25)

Пример для ячейки A1:

=СТЕПЕНЬ(A1; 0,25)
  • 📌 Преимущество: ясный синтаксис, легко читается в формулах.
  • 🔢 Нюанс: при работе с большими массивами данных (тысячи строк) может замедлять пересчет листа. В таких случаях лучше использовать оператор ^.
  • 🔄 Альтернатива: для корня n-й степени замените 0,25 на 1/n.

Если вам нужно извлечь корень четвертой степени из суммы нескольких ячеек, комбинируйте СТЕПЕНЬ() с СУММ():

=СТЕПЕНЬ(СУММ(A1:A10); 0,25)

Способ 4: Работа с комплексными числами (для отрицательных значений)

При извлечении корня четвертой степени из отрицательного числа (например, -16) стандартные функции Excel возвращают ошибку #ЧИСЛО!. Это связано с тем, что результат в таком случае — комплексное число (например, корень четвертой степени из -16 равен 2i, где i — мнимая единица).

Для работы с комплексными числами в Excel предусмотрены специальные функции:

  • 🔢 КОМПЛЕКСН() — создает комплексное число.
  • 📊 ИМДЕЛ() — извлекает корень n-й степени из комплексного числа.

Пример вычисления корня четвертой степени из -16:

=ИМДЕЛ(КОМПЛЕКСН(-16; 0); 4)

Результат: 1,22464679914735E-16 + 2i (где мнимая часть ≈ 2).

⚠️ Внимание: Функции для комплексных чисел доступны только в Excel 2013 и новее. В Excel 2010 и более ранних версиях для таких расчетов потребуется надстройка Analysis ToolPak или ручной ввод формул через мнимые единицы.
Как интерпретировать комплексный результат?

Комплексное число в формате a + bi означает, что действительная часть результата — a, а мнимая — b. Например, 2i эквивалентно 0 + 2i, то есть число лежит на мнимой оси. В физике и инженерии такие результаты часто преобразуют в полярную форму для дальнейших расчетов.

Способ 5: Использование надстройки Analysis ToolPak для массовых вычислений

Если вам нужно вычислить корни четвертой степени для большого диапазона данных (например, столбец из 10 000 чисел), ручной ввод формул может быть неэффективным. В этом случае поможет надстройка Analysis ToolPak, которая добавляет дополнительные инженерные функции.

Алгоритм действий:

  1. Активируйте надстройку: перейдите в Файл → Параметры → Надстройки → Управление: Надстройки Excel → Перейти и отметьте Analysis ToolPak.
  2. Используйте функцию ИМСТЕПЕНЬ() для комплексных чисел или создайте пользовательскую функцию на VBA для ускорения расчетов.

Пример пользовательской функции на VBA для корня 4-й степени:

Function Root4(x As Double) As Double

Root4 = x ^ (1/4)

End Function

После добавления этого кода в редактор VBA (Alt + F11) вы сможете использовать =Root4(A1) как обычную функцию.

Типичные ошибки и как их избежать

Даже опытные пользователи Excel сталкиваются с ошибками при вычислении корней. Вот наиболее распространенные из них и способы их решения:

  • 🚨 Ошибка #ЧИСЛО!: Возникает при извлечении корня четной степени из отрицательного числа. Решение: Используйте комплексные числа (см. Способ 4) или проверяйте знак числа функцией ЕСЛИ().
  • 🔢 Неверный результат: Часто связан с неправильным форматом ячейки. Убедитесь, что ячейка с результатом имеет формат Общий или Числовой.
  • 📉 Медленные расчеты: При работе с большими массивами отключите автоматический пересчет (Формулы → Параметры вычислений → Вручную) и обновляйте данные по мере необходимости.

Пример проверки знака числа перед извлечением корня:

=ЕСЛИ(A1<0; "Ошибка: отрицательное"; A1^(1/4))

Если вы работаете с данными, где возможны отрицательные значения, добавьте столбец с проверкой:

=ЕСЛИОШИБКА(A1^(1/4); "Комплексное число")

FAQ: Частые вопросы по вычислению корней в Excel

Можно ли извлечь корень четвертой степени без использования формул?

Нет, в Excel нет встроенной кнопки для извлечения корня n-й степени. Все расчеты выполняются через формулы или надстройки. Однако вы можете создать собственную кнопку с макросом на VBA, который будет автоматизировать процесс.

Почему результат вычисления корня отличается от калькулятора?

Разница обычно связана с округлением. Excel по умолчанию отображает 11 знаков после запятой, но в расчетах использует 15. Чтобы увидеть точный результат, измените формат ячейки на Числовой с нужным количеством десятичных знаков.

Как извлечь корень четвертой степени из дроби?

Дробь можно представить как деление двух чисел. Например, для корня из 16/81 используйте:

=СТЕПЕНЬ(16/81; 0,25)

или

=КОРЕНЬ(КОРЕНЬ(16/81))
Можно ли использовать эти методы в Google Sheets?

Да, все описанные способы (оператор ^, функции КОРЕНЬ() и СТЕПЕНЬ()) работают и в Google Таблицах. Синтаксис идентичен, за исключением названий функций на английском (SQRT() вместо КОРЕНЬ()).

Как автоматизировать вычисления для динамических данных?

Используйте динамические массивыExcel 365) или таблицы Excel (в более ранних версиях). Например, формула

=СТЕПЕНЬ(A1:A100; 0,25)

автоматически рассчитает корень для всего диапазона A1:A100 и обновит результаты при изменении исходных данных.